The sports festival is coming up, and Haruna and Yoh both choose to be rooters so they can spend more time together. However, Yoh is elected captain for both his grade and the school, which means he has special practices apart from Haruna. With Yoh absent, Asaoka starts making a move on Haruna...
I felt that this volume wasn't up to standard with the rest of the series. There were some funny moments, but the overall plot was kind of boring and slow. It didn't feel like the story progressed enough for a whole volume. Also, Asaoka's kind of unlikable in this volume, although he wasn't out of character.
"High School Debut" does tend to vary a little in story quality. There have been other slow patches, but it's always picked back up. Let's hope volume 10 picks up the slack.

By setlib This is my favorite volume so far in the series because Yoh is forced to come out of his shell and fight for his relationship with Haruna. First, he is elected captain of the White Team in the school sports competition and has to stand up in front of all the other students and lead the cheers -- which is a pretty scary proposal for someone who has difficulty expressing himself. He does an amazing job and looks really fabulous, definitely one of the high points in the series for me. He has to put in lots of extra hours after school to practice, leaving Haruna alone...until Asaoka takes advantage of the situation to start spending more time with her. Finally things come to a head when Asaoka tells Yoh he has feelings for Haruna and wants to tell her, and they end up with a challenge -- if Yoh's team wins, Asaoka has to keep quiet. Yoh will have to pull out all the stops to defend his relationship with Haruna. Does his team win? You'll have to read volume 10 to find out!
